So how long does a septic system last?
The honest short answer: a properly cared-for conventional septic system commonly lasts 25 to 30 years, and many run longer. But that headline number is almost useless on its own, because a septic system is really several parts with their own clocks. The tank, the drain field, the pipes, and any pumps or filters all wear out at different speeds.
Think of it like a car. The frame might outlast everything, but tires, brakes, and the battery need replacing on their own schedules. With septic, the “tires” are usually the drain field, and replacing it is the repair that hurts. Lifespan by component: the numbers that matter
Here is where the single-number myth falls apart. Some parts are near-permanent; others are almost consumable. The table below shows typical, widely-accepted ranges. Treat them as planning guides, not guarantees, since soil, climate, water use, and build quality all move the needle.
| Component | Typical lifespan | What ends its life |
|---|---|---|
| Concrete tank | 40+ years | Cracking, corrosion from gases over decades |
| Steel tank | 15 to 20 years | Rust through the walls and lid |
| Plastic or fiberglass tank | 30 to 40 years | Damage from shifting soil or heavy loads |
| Drain field (leach field) | 20 to 30 years | Clogging, compaction, biomat buildup |
| Distribution pipes and D-box | 20 to 30 years | Root intrusion, crushing, settling |
| Effluent filter | Clean yearly; replace as needed | Wear and clogging |
| Pump (in pump systems) | 5 to 15 years | Motor burnout, electrical failure |
The tank: often the longest-lived part
Most modern tanks are concrete, and a good concrete tank can quietly do its job for 40 years or more. Its enemies are slow: cracking as the ground shifts and gradual corrosion of the concrete above the waterline from the gases inside. Older steel tanks are the exception, because they rust from the inside out and commonly fail at 15 to 20 years, sometimes with a collapsing lid, which is a genuine safety hazard.
The drain field: usually the first to fail
This is the part that decides most people’s “how long” answer. Effluent leaving the tank soaks into the drain field, where soil and a natural biological layer (the biomat) finish the treatment. Over 20 to 30 years, that biomat thickens and the soil’s ability to absorb water declines. Push too much water or too many solids into it and that decline speeds up dramatically. Because replacement is the big-ticket repair, the drain field deserves the most protection, a theme we return to below.
Your system type changes the math
A simple gravity-fed conventional system has no moving parts to fail, so it can age gracefully. Systems with pumps, aerators, or advanced treatment units add components that wear out faster, a pump might need replacing in 5 to 15 years, which shortens the average time between repairs. What shortens a septic system’s life
Almost every early failure I have seen traces back to one of a handful of habits. The good news is that they are all within a homeowner’s control. Here are the biggest lifespan-killers, roughly in order of how much damage they do.
- Skipping pumping. When solids are never removed, they build up and flow out into the drain field, clogging it permanently. This is the number one way people destroy an otherwise healthy field.
- Overloading with water. Running laundry all day, leaky fixtures, and long simultaneous showers flood the tank so solids do not settle and the field never gets to dry out.
- Flushing the wrong things. Wipes, grease, “flushable” products, and harsh chemicals either clog pipes or kill the bacteria that make the system work.
- Driving or parking over it. Vehicles and heavy equipment compact the soil and can crush pipes or crack the tank lid.
- Planting trees nearby. Roots seek out the moisture and nutrients in your lines and can invade and block them within a few seasons.
- Ignoring early warning signs. Slow drains, odors, or a soggy patch in the yard are cheap to investigate now and expensive to ignore.
Warning: a clogged field rarely “recovers”
Once solids have flowed into and clogged a drain field, no additive or pump-out reliably brings it back. At that point you are usually looking at partial or full replacement, the most expensive repair on a septic system. Protecting the field is far cheaper than resurrecting it, so treat pumping and water habits as non-negotiable.

How to make your septic system last longer
Extending a system’s life is not complicated, but it is a routine, not a one-time fix. Work through these steps and repeat the recurring ones on schedule. The payoff is real: consistent care can add ten years or more to the parts you least want to replace.
- Pump the tank every 3 to 5 years, adjusting for tank size and household size. A big family on a 1,000-gallon tank may need it closer to every 2 to 3 years.
- Get an inspection at each pump-out so a professional catches cracks, root intrusion, or baffle damage early.
- Spread out water use. Run laundry across the week, fix running toilets promptly, and install low-flow fixtures.
- Flush only human waste and toilet paper. Keep wipes, grease, and chemicals out of every drain.
- Keep vehicles, sheds, and heavy equipment completely off the tank and drain field.
- Plant only grass over the field, and keep trees and deep-rooted shrubs well away.
- Keep a written maintenance record so you (and a future buyer) know exactly when each service happened.
A worked example: neglect vs. care
Picture two identical homes built the same year with identical concrete-tank systems. On my own system, I pump every four years (about $450 a time here) and keep water use spread out; roughly a decade in, an inspection still shows a solid tank and a field with plenty of life left.
My neighbor never pumped, parked a trailer over the field, and let a maple grow beside the lines. At about year 14, solids had migrated into the field and roots had invaded the pipes. His “fix” was a new drain field that ran well over $10,000. Same equipment, same soil, roughly half the lifespan, purely because of habits. That gap is the whole point of this article.
Tip: the cheapest life extender is a filter
If your tank does not have an effluent filter on the outlet, adding one is an inexpensive upgrade that catches stray solids before they reach the drain field. It is one of the highest-return, lowest-cost things you can do to protect the part of your system you most want to keep alive. Ask about it at your next pump-out.
Signs your system is nearing the end
An aging system usually warns you before it quits. Catching these signs early can mean a repair instead of a full replacement. Watch for these patterns, especially if your system is already past the 20-year mark.
- Drains throughout the house getting slower, not just one fixture.
- Sewage odors indoors or a persistent smell over the tank or field.
- Soggy ground, lush green stripes, or standing water above the drain field.
- Gurgling pipes or backups, especially after heavy water use or rain.
- Needing to pump far more often than you used to.

Frequently Asked Questions
How long does a septic system last on average?
A well-maintained conventional septic system commonly lasts 25 to 30 years, and many run longer. That average hides big differences between parts: a concrete tank can last 40 or more years, while the drain field typically fails first at 20 to 30 years. Maintenance is the biggest variable in either direction.
What part of a septic system fails first?
The drain field is almost always the first part to fail, usually at 20 to 30 years. Effluent gradually clogs the soil and a biological layer thickens until the ground can no longer absorb water. It is also the most expensive part to replace, which is why protecting it matters most.
How long does a concrete septic tank last?
A quality concrete septic tank often lasts 40 years or more. Its main enemies are slow: cracking as soil shifts and gradual corrosion from the gases inside. Steel tanks last much less, commonly 15 to 20 years, because they rust through, and a rusted lid can be a serious safety hazard.
Can you extend the life of a septic system?
Yes, quite a lot. Pumping every three to five years, spreading out water use, keeping vehicles and trees off the drain field, and flushing only waste and toilet paper can add a decade or more. Neglecting those same basics can cut a system’s life roughly in half, so habits are the biggest factor you control.
Is a 30-year-old septic system too old?
Not necessarily. Many systems run well past 30 years with good care, especially those with concrete tanks. But at that age you should have it inspected regularly and budget for eventual drain field replacement. If you are buying a home with an older system, always get a professional inspection before you close.
